My Fair Lady
Based upon George Bernard Shaw's Pygmalion
A distinguished phonetics professor from London’s upper crust places a friendly wager that a common flower girl from the streets can be transformed into a lady, simply by teaching her to speak properly. Little does he know that she may have something of her own to teach. This recently discovered, two-piano adaptation of Lerner and Loewe’s sparkling score includes “I Could Have Danced All Night,” “Get Me To The Church On Time” and “On the Street Where You Live.” My Fair Lady is one of the greatest stories of the stage and a musical masterpiece for the whole family.
